Review: SELinux by Example
If you use Linux then you've most probably at least heard of
Security-Enhanced Linux (SELinux). In this feature story R
yan W. Maple gives a review and his opinion of the latest
and greatest book to cover SELinux: SELinux by Example:
Using Security Enhanced Linux. Read on for Ryan's review.
"SELinux by Example" is a hands-on book aimed towards anybody
interested in Security-Enhanced Linux (SELinux). Whether you
want to learn how to write SELinux policy or administer a
machine running SELinux, you will find tremendous value in
this book. Each chapter conveniently wraps up with a
bullet-point summary of the material that was covered and
some exercises which do an excellent job of driving the
points home, giving this book it's "hands-on" feel.
The book is written by Frank Mayer (the co-founder and CTO
of Tresys Technology), David Caplan (a senior security
engineer with Tresys), and Karl Macmillan (a very active
contributor to the SELinux community), three of the most
qualified people to write a book on this complicated
subject. It consists of 14 chapters and four appendices,
grouped into three main parts: SELinux Overview, SELinux
Policy Language, and Creating and Writing SELinux
Security Policies.
This is a very good book and is easily the best I've seen
yet on the subject of SELinux. If you've been tasked with
maintaining an SELinux-enabled machine, would like to
write or enhance existing SELinux policy, or just want
to understand what SELinux is and how it came to be,
then this is the book for you. This book and an
SELinux-enabled Linux distribution, such as the easy
to use EnGarde Secure Linux, are all you need to get
involved in the growing world of Security Enhanced
Linux.

RFID with Bio-Smart Card in Linux
In this paper, we describe the integration of fingerprint template
and RF smart card for clustered network, which is designed on Linux
platform and Open source technology to obtain biometrics security.
Combination of smart card and biometrics has achieved in two step
authentication where smart card authentication is based on a
Personal Identification Number (PIN) and the card holder is
authenticated using the biometrics template stored in the smart
card that is based on the fingerprint verification. The fingerprint
verification has to be executed on central host server for
security purposes. Protocol designed allows controlling entire
parameters of smart security controller like PIN options, Reader
delay, real-time clock, alarm option and cardholder access
conditions.

* Ubuntu: OpenSSL vulnerability
16th, October, 2006
Philip Mackenzie, Marius Schilder, Jason Waddle and Ben Laurie of
Google Security discovered that the OpenSSL library did not
sufficiently check the padding of PKCS #1 v1.5 signatures if the
exponent of the public key is 3 (which is widely used for CAs). This
could be exploited to forge signatures without the need of the secret
key.

* Ubuntu: ffmpeg, xine-lib vulnerabilities
16th, October, 2006
XFOCUS Security Team discovered that the AVI decoder used in xine-lib
did not correctly validate certain headers. By tricking a user into
playing an AVI with malicious headers, an attacker could execute
arbitrary code with the target user's privileges. (CVE-2006-4799)
Multiple integer overflows were discovered in ffmpeg and tools that
contain a copy of ffmpeg (like xine-lib and kino), for several types
of video formats. By tricking a user into running a video player that
uses ffmpeg on a stream with malicious content, an attacker could
execute arbitrary code with the target user's privileges.
(CVE-2006-4800)

* Ubuntu: OpenSSL vulnerability
16th, October, 2006
USN-353-1 fixed several vulnerabilities in OpenSSL. However, Mark J
Cox noticed that the applied patch for CVE-2006-2940 was flawed. This
update corrects that patch. For reference, this is the relevant part
of the original advisory: Certain types of public key could take
disproportionate amounts of time to process. The library now limits
the maximum key exponent size to avoid Denial of Service attacks.
(CVE-2006-2940)

* Ubuntu: awstats vulnerabilities
16th, October, 2006
awstats did not fully sanitize input, which was passed directly to
the user's browser, allowing for an XSS attack. If a user was
tricked into following a specially crafted awstats URL, the user's
authentication information could be exposed for the domain where
awstats was hosted. (CVE-2006-3681) awstats could display its
installation path under certain conditions. However, this might only
become a concern if awstats is installed into an user's home
directory. (CVE-2006-3682)
